Tulsa Bicycle Tours Tulsa Bicycle Tours

Experience the charm of Tulsa with Tulsa Bicycle Tours, a locally owned and operated company dedicated to providing unique bike tours that showcase the city's beauty. With knowledgeable guides leading the way, you'll explore prominent neighborhoods, historic concert venues, original Route 66, the Arkansas River, and one of the world's largest collections of Art Deco architecture. Moreover, the comfortable and easy-to-ride Tulsa-built bikes make touring a breeze. Plus, you can start your tour from your office, house, or hotel, as they bring you a stocked trailer with all the necessary equipment.

Tulsa Greek Festival Tulsa Greek Festival

If it's September, you might want to check out the Greek Holiday Festival sponsored by the Holy Trinity Greek Orthodox Church. It's a fantastic celebration of all things Greek, including dance, drink, and food. You'll feel like you've been transported right to the Greek Isles. And speaking of significant food events, Tulsa has its fantastic celebration of Greek culture and cuisine. The annual festival celebrates 50 years of bringing together the community to enjoy traditional dishes and learn more about Greek traditions. If you're feeling competitive, try the Lord of the Fries, a hilarious and messy fry-eating competition. Teams of two work together to see who can eat the most fries before time runs out, and the winning team earns the coveted title of "Lords (or Ladies) of the Fries."
